About the role

Performs safe and accurate blood collection and disposition across various hospital and outpatient settings. Handles administrative tasks, patient registration, and maintains laboratory records using information systems.

Performs phlebotomy functions and non-technical duties in areas including the hospital laboratory, outpatient and off-site services.

Responsible for the safe and accurate collection and disposition of blood samples and responsible for performing associate's laboratory duties.

Interacts with patients, physicians and hospital staff members in a professional manner.

Serves as receptionist for patients and hospital staff conducting business with the laboratory.

Performs clerical duties as needed to create, maintain and communicate patient data to health care providers.

Essential Functions Demonstrates complete knowledge and understanding of established department and hospital policies and procedures as evidenced by job performance.

Follows strict guidelines for patient identification and specimen labeling by verification of patient name and DOB.

Evaluates patient for contraindication for blood collection procedures, such as burns, IV’s, posted signs, etc.

Demonstrates competency in blood collection of all age brackets: neonates, pediatrics, adolescents, adults and geriatrics.

Requests assistance in restraining uncooperative or pediatric patients in venipuncture.

Follows proper procedure for sterile technique.

Understands specimen type, tube type and volume required for each test requested.

Documents cancellation of test in order comments.

Utilizes Order Comments when required.

Reviews and signs Pending Reports with oncoming staff prior to the end of shift.

Properly disposes of biohazardous material.

Performs administrative and clerical tasks such as filing important records, registering patients, maintaining patient records in a filing system, retrieving data, and sending reports to physicians via phone, mail, fax, or computer.

Operates laboratory information system effectively to enter and retrieve patient data.

Takes an active role in the laboratory education and training (in-service) program to maintain staff competency.

Participates in periodic department meetings and in-service programs when held.

Attends all mandatory hospital and section safety, risk management, quality assurance, etc. meetings.

All other duties as assigned.

Education High School Diploma or GED Certification Basic Life Support (BLS) from American Red Cross (ARC) or American Heart Association (AHA) Work Experience Previous hospital experience. New graduate at the discretion of the Director.
